Ask any Mumbaikar for their deepest food story, and they will point to a grey, pouring July afternoon. The story is of bhutta —roasted corn on the cob, smeared with lemon and chili powder—eaten under an umbrella. Or of pakoras (fritters) and kadak (strong) ginger tea, as the rain hammers the tin roof. These are not meals; they are memories of relief and joy.

Wearing these garments is an act of cultural preservation. Even as global fast-fashion dominates urban malls, young Indians are increasingly turning back to handloom fabrics, reimagining traditional textiles into contemporary silhouettes like crop tops paired with sarees or hand-blocked blazers.
